Transaction 785396d3c1652ceb9bb69435331ddd44d7f7baab4ef1fa0dd991e183ec4d8224
1 Input
2 Outputs
- 785396d3c1652ceb9bb69435331ddd44d7f7baab4ef1fa0dd991e183ec4d8224:0
- 785396d3c1652ceb9bb69435331ddd44d7f7baab4ef1fa0dd991e183ec4d8224:1
value 528415
address 1C17XRvZaMmzVt4ESbseYwxowasixZj1Fg
value 4490992864
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n